Shiites Choose Adel Abdul Mahdi as PM Candidate

Shiites Choose Adel Abdul Mahdi as PM Candidate

Juan Cole

Al-Hayat writing in Arabic reports that the Shiite fundamentalist coalition, the National Iraqi Alliance, has conducted a vote and selected Adel Abdul Mahdi as the list’s candidate for the post of prime minister. Abdul Mahdi is the outgoing vice president of Iraq and is from the Islamic Supreme Council of Iraq (ISCI). Four major parties […]

Shiite Procession Bombed in Lahore: 35 Dead, 250 Wounded

Shiite Procession Bombed in Lahore: 35 Dead, 250 Wounded

Juan Cole

Three explosions hit Shiite processions in the old city of Lahore around 7 pm Wednesday, killing at least 35 persons and wounding about 250. The first explosion appears to have been a pre-set bomb, which went off near to the Karbala Gamay Shiite shrine. Two suicide bombers subsequently struck near Bhati Chowk. The attacks occurred […]

Netanyahu Reneges on Freeze

Netanyahu Reneges on Freeze

Juan Cole

Israeli Prime Minister Binyamin Netanyahu announced his bad faith as he began the first direct talks between Israel and the Palestine Authority in 2 years, implying that he would call off the 8-month freeze on new settlements in the West Bank. His negotiating partner, President Mahmoud Abbas, had made cessation of new settlements a prerequisite […]
